Hexnode and Miradore are both notable solutions in the field of mobile device management (MDM), but they showcase distinct differences in terms of their scope, features, and target audiences.
Hexnode stands out for its comprehensive approach to managing mobile devices, applications, content, and security settings. It offers a user-friendly interface and robust security measures, making it a compelling option for organizations seeking efficient and secure device management across various platforms. Hexnode's focus on versatility and its ability to provide a unified management experience for a broad range of devices highlights its commitment to a user-centric and comprehensive MDM solution.
In contrast, Miradore specializes in offering a simplified device management experience with features like device inventory, application deployment, and security settings. It caters to organizations looking for straightforward device management without the complexities of larger enterprise solutions. Miradore's strength lies in its ease of use and streamlined approach, making it an appealing choice for small to medium-sized businesses or those with limited IT resources.
